Econolite Canada Offers RTMS® G4(TM) Vehicle Detection and Traffic Measurement


Anaheim, Calif. - Econolite Canada, today announced it has expanded its vehicle detection and traffic measurement capabilities by offering RTMS® (Remote Traffic Microwave Sensor) G4(TM) to the Canadian transportation management industry. This RTMS offering builds upon the successful 20-year technology and product development partnership between Image Sensing Systems, Inc. (ISS) and Econolite.

According to Econolite Canada, RTMS G4 is the newest generation radar sensor for vehicle detection and traffic measurement, adding to Econolite Canada's growing portfolio of strategic Intelligent Transportation System (ITS) capabilities. The RTMS G4 is a roadside radar detection system that is easy and safe to install without traffic disruptions or lane closures. The G4 combines a high-resolution radar, with options for contact closures, serial communications, wireless communications, and Ethernet communications with an IP camera to view traffic scenes, all within a single enclosure. The G4 offers convenient Bluetooth communications for setup, calibration and data access, allowing technicians to connect from their service vehicle at the roadside. Its sleek, cabinet-free detection station is simple to integrate into any traffic management system.
